FRESNO, Calif. (KFSN) -- Action News has learned a correctional officer at the Fresno County jail has tested positive for coronavirus.

The Fresno County Sheriff's Office and the county public health department said they will begin contact tracing other jail staff members. They will also isolate inmates who were in contact with the officer.
